I wouldn't play the deck without Punishing Fire and Grove. It's so good in so many matchups. Good luck trying to beat D&T or Elves without it. Elves especially is traditionally an abysmal matchup and for B/G based decks and Punishing Fire single handedly turns it into a decent matchup (though chalice obviously helps too). It also helps you slog through planeswalkers and can really be invaluable against miracles because it keeps Jace in check and with enough land helps deal with a medium sized entreat. It also has great synergy with Liliana and Loam. If you want to play a deck like this without that combo, you'd be better off playing Maverick.
